A 23 year old man was found roaming aimlessly near New Delhi Railway Station. When the police enquired about his whereabouts he appeared confused and was not able to tell details about his name and address. He was not able to give any information about how he reached the railway station and could not recall anything about his past. His belongings included an AADHAR CARD, where the address was of srinagar, jammu & kashmir. When his family was contacted, they repoed that his father had died yesterday and since than he went missing. What is the likely diagnosis?

A
Dissociative fugue
B
Dissociative identity disorder
C
Post traumatic stress disorder
D
Depersonlaization/derealization
High-Yield Explanation
History of a travel, with inability to recall details of travel and inability to recall impoant personal information is suggestive of dissociative fugue. The presence of a stressor , fuher aids in the diagnosis. Kindly remember that in DSM-5, dissociative fugue has been subsumed under the diagnosis of dissociative amnesia.
